CRACKING the CODING INTERVIEW - Home
Prepare for software engineering interviews with practice questions, solutions, and expert tips from a renowned book and resource for coding interviews.
Cracking the Coding Interview is designed to help you get ready for software engineering interviews at top tech companies. The site offers practical resources, including a best-selling book packed with programming interview questions, detailed solutions, and insider advice from a former Google hiring committee member.
Whether you're just starting your job search or aiming to land your dream role, you can access proven strategies, coding challenges, and hints to boost your confidence. The latest edition features even more questions and content, making it a comprehensive companion for anyone preparing for technical interviews.
If you want to improve your problem-solving skills and get familiar with the types of questions leading companies ask, this platform gives you the tools and knowledge to perform at your best.
Discover websites similar to Crackingthecodinginterview.com. Optimized for ultra-fast loading.
Flatiron School offers online and on-campus bootcamps in coding, data science, cybersecurity, and design to help you launch a tech career.
Scaler offers live online courses and programs to help tech professionals upskill in software development, data science, and machine learning.
Uncodemy offers IT training courses in Data Science, Full Stack Development, Python, Java, Digital Marketing, and more across major cities in India.
Learn coding and boost your tech career with structured courses, expert instructors, and fast doubt resolution on this leading programming education platform.
인프런은 프로그래밍, AI, 데이터, 마케팅 등 다양한 분야의 온라인 강의를 제공하는 한국어 교육 플랫폼입니다.
Learn coding, data, UX, and more with tech bootcamps and courses designed to help you start or switch to a technology career. Both full-time and part-time options.
Brototype offers intensive tech training and career support for young Indians, helping you become a software engineer regardless of your academic background.
Learn iOS development with courses, books, and interview prep resources designed to help you grow your skills and advance your iOS developer career.
Prepare for tech interviews with expert-led system design, coding, and behavioral courses, plus mock interviews and resume reviews for job seekers.
Google Summer of Code connects new contributors with open source organizations for mentored programming projects in a global, online program.
Learn C and C++ with step-by-step tutorials, practice problems, and helpful tips for beginners and experienced programmers alike.
Learn JavaScript online with Eric Elliott. Access practical lessons, tips, and resources to boost your coding skills and make a real impact.
Java67 offers Java tutorials, interview questions, and course recommendations to help programmers learn, practice, and prepare for tech interviews.
A Russian-language platform offering programming courses, tutorials, and resources to help you learn coding and computer science skills online.
Find in-depth JavaScript books and resources for programmers. Learn modern JavaScript concepts and best practices through clear, expert writing.
Explore intermediate Python topics with clear explanations, code examples, and practical tips to help you deepen your programming skills.
Practice real programming interview questions and get step-by-step help to prepare for tech job interviews at top companies like Google and Facebook.
Learn to Code HTML & CSS offers clear, step-by-step lessons for beginners and advanced users to master web development basics, all for free online.
TestDriven.io offers hands-on courses and tutorials on test-driven development, microservices, and web development using popular frameworks and tools.
Learn to design and code real apps with hands-on courses in React, Swift, UI design, and development tools like Figma and SwiftUI. Build practical skills online.
Learn Python from scratch or improve your skills with this ebook and online platform, offering clear lessons, examples, and resources in Spanish and English.
NeetCode helps you prepare for coding interviews with curated coding problems, tutorials, and learning resources for technical job seekers.
Learn ClojureScript offers an easy-to-follow book and tutorials for anyone wanting to master ClojureScript and build web apps with functional programming.
Machine Learning Mastery helps developers learn machine learning with practical tutorials, guides, and resources for faster, hands-on skill building.
Join a self-directed programming retreat in NYC or online to build projects, grow your skills, and connect with a supportive community of coders.
Learn JavaScript, Angular, React, and more with expert-led online courses designed to help you master modern web development skills at your own pace.
CodeGym offers an interactive online Java course with 1200+ practice tasks, personalized learning plans, and a mix of theory and hands-on coding.
Learn how to use Python to automate everyday tasks. Read the full book online for free and follow practical lessons to boost your coding skills.
Udacity offers online courses in tech fields like programming, data science, AI, and business to help you build practical skills and advance your career.
FavTutor offers online courses in data structures, algorithms, and data science, helping you build coding skills through structured learning and practice.
TechTrain offers personalized programming courses and mentorship from top engineers, helping you boost your skills and advance your IT career in Japan.
Aprende desarrollo web, móvil, IA, ciberseguridad y más con bootcamps online en español para impulsar tu carrera tecnológica desde cero.
Learn coding at your own pace with beginner-friendly courses in Python, JavaScript, HTML, and CSS. Start for free and build real skills for tech jobs.
Dive Into Python 3 is an online book that teaches Python 3 programming, highlighting key differences from Python 2 with clear examples and updated content.
Learn programming and software design with interactive lessons, exercises, and examples based on the popular "How to Design Programs" book.
Practice real system design problems interactively to prepare for interviews. Learn by doing, not just reading, and improve your system design skills.
Learn Python programming with free video and text tutorials, covering topics from beginner basics to advanced machine learning and data analysis.
Learn Python the Hard Way offers beginner-friendly online courses and books that teach you to code in Python from scratch, with no prior experience needed.
A Japanese beginner’s guide to TypeScript, offering practical lessons, summaries, and tips for developers who want to use TypeScript in real projects.
Thinkster offers interactive tutorials and screencasts to help you quickly learn modern JavaScript frameworks and web development skills.
Discover tools and services similar to crackingthecodinginterview.com
Explore related tools and services in these categories